AMERICA/ECUADOR - “We urge the people and all social and political forces to unite efforts to promote the good of the country. Congress must correct its attitudes and actions and think only of the common good”: Bishops launch concerned appeal

Quito (Fides Service) - The Church in Ecuador, attentive to the phenomena which strike the people has on various occasions called attention to growing malcontent among the people with the country in an economic, social and moral crisis. This was a sign that the country was moving towards a slippery slope to anarchy, dictatorship or even civil war, fighting among brothers of the same nation, which unfortunately has occurred. In recent weeks Ecuador has lived days of general mobilisation, harsh suppression of demonstrations with a tragic toll of dead and injured leading to the destitution of President Lucio Gutiérrez harshly criticised by the people.
In a statement dated April 21 the Bishops’ Conference of Ecuador expressed support for the new President Alfredo Palacio implying that parliament achieved a presidential succession in the framework of legal and constitutional norms. “The Bishops’ Conference urged the government to straighten its steps with absolute fidelity to the law and the constitution; and to restore to the country the peace necessary for its development, always listening to the aspirations of the people”. The Bishops call on the people, and all social and political forces to unite efforts to promote the good of the nation urging parliament to correct its attitudes and activity and be concerned solely for the common good. Lastly the Bishops call on the armed forces to help consolidate the state of law long desired by Ecuador. Tomorrow Fides will give ulterior information on the situation Ecuador (R.Z.)
